All contestants of 'The Amazing Race' are awarded money. The show that has been running successfully for 32 seasons, takes eleven teams in pairs with a preexisting relationship (as seen in most cases) and sends them to one of the most famous races across the world.

With eight rounds of elimination, the final three pairs go compete in the finale to win the grand prize of a whopping $1 million! Having said that, each of the ten losing teams also gets rewarded with a cash prize of varying amounts.

Apart from this, there are also smaller prizes up for grabs, in cash as well as paid trips, cars. That being said, the information on the exact amount is unclear by CBS, since the rest of the participants are awarded in terms of compensation for their efforts. According to Men's Health, every team does get some form of pay, one way or another.

With $1 million being the grand prize for the first place winners, Men's Health also revealed that the runners-up get an amount of $25,000 to split between them, while the team that comes in third wins an amount of $10,000. The team in 11th place gets the lowest cash prize of $1,500, while the team placing in the 10th position gets awarded $2,500. From here, the winnings increase by $500 all the way up, to 4th place.
